      最近在网上看到一些朋友到处找类似于google的个性主页和msn space的拖拽实现,在下正好也找到了一个例子.但是问题比较多.我将其改写并完善,建立了一个通用的函数.具体的函数实现如下:

<script type="text/javascript" language="javascript">
<!--
/*
 ====================================
|--------Author By BlackSoul---------|
|------------2006.03.30--------------|
|--------BlackSoulylk@gmail.com------|
|------------QQ:9136194--------------|
|------http://blacksoul.cnblogs.cn---|
 ====================================
*/
//设置层对象
var aim;
var sourceLayer;
var cloneLayer;
 
//定义各个层初始位置
var aimX;
var aimY;
var orgnX;
var orgnY;
 
//拖拽过程中的变量
var draging = false; //是否处于拖拽中
var offsetX = 0;     //X方向左右偏移量
var offsetY = 0;     //Y方向上下偏移量
var back;            //返回动画对象
var thisX ;          //当前clone层的X位置
var thisY ;          //当前clone层的Y位置
var time ;
var stepX ;          //位移速度
var stepY ;          //位移速度
 
//初始化拖拽信息
/*
 initAimX 目标x坐标
 initAimY 目标y坐标
 initOrgnX 拖拽源x坐标
 initOrgnY 拖拽源y坐标
*/
//获得层对象
 
function getLayer(inAim,inSource,inClone)
{
    aim = document.getElementById(inAim);
    sourceLayer = document.getElementById(inSource);
    cloneLayer = document.getElementById(inClone);
}
 
function initDrag(initAimX,initAimY,initOrgnX,initOrgnY)
{
    aimX = initAimX;
    aimY = initAimY;
    orgnX = initOrgnX;
    orgnY = initOrgnY;
    //设置各个开始层的位置
    aim.style.pixelLeft = aimX;
    aim.style.pixelTop = aimY;
    sourceLayer.style.pixelLeft = orgnX;
    sourceLayer.style.pixelTop = orgnY;
    cloneLayer.style.pixelLeft = orgnX;
    cloneLayer.style.pixelTop = orgnY;
}
 
//准备拖拽
function BeforeDrag()
{
    if (event.button != 1)
    {
        return;
    }
    cloneLayer.innerHTML = sourceLayer.innerHTML; //复制拖拽源内容
    offsetX = document.body.scrollLeft + event.clientX - sourceLayer.style.pixelLeft;
    offsetY = document.body.scrollTop + event.clientY - sourceLayer.style.pixelTop;
    cloneLayer.className = "actived";
    draging = true;
}
 
//拖拽中
function OnDrag()
{
    if(!draging)
    {
        return;
    }
    //更新位置
    event.returnValue = false;
    cloneLayer.style.pixelLeft = document.body.scrollLeft + event.clientX - offsetX;
    cloneLayer.style.pixelTop = document.body.scrollTop + event.clientY - offsetY;
}
 
//结束拖拽
function EndDrag()
{
    if (event.button != 1)
    {
       return;
    }
    draging = false;
 
    if (event.clientX >= aim.style.pixelLeft && event.clientX <= (aim.style.pixelLeft + aim.offsetWidth) &&
        event.clientY >= aim.style.pixelTop && event.clientY <= (aim.style.pixelTop + aim.offsetHeight))
    {
        //拖拽层位于目标中,自动定位到目标位置
        sourceLayer.style.pixelLeft = aim.style.pixelLeft;
        sourceLayer.style.pixelTop = aim.style.pixelTop;
         cloneLayer.className = "docked";
         /*
         ** 这里完成之后可以用xml保存当前位置.
         ** 下次用户进入的时候
         ** 就初始化源拖拽层为xml当中的数据了    
         */
    }
    else
    {
    //拖拽位于目标层外,将拖拽源位置复原
     thisX = cloneLayer.style.pixelLeft;
     thisY = cloneLayer.style.pixelTop;
     offSetX = Math.abs(thisX - orgnX);
     offSetY = Math.abs(thisY - orgnY);
     time = 500;//设置动画时间
     stepX = Math.floor((offSetX/time)*20);
     stepY = Math.floor((offSetY/time)*20);
     if(stepX == 0)
         stepX = 2;
     if(stepY == 0)
         stepY = 2;
        
    //开始返回动画
     moveStart();
    }   
}

需要注意的是:
一.html里面对于div的定义需要有三个. 三个层都必须定义style的position为absolute,以便控制位置
    1.目标层(aim),主要作用是定义拖拽生效的位置.
    2.拖拽源(sourceLayer).注意设置属性unselectable = "off"(这里比较奇怪,设置成on范围会在拖拽过程中选中层内容)
    3.用于复制的层(cloneLayer).
二.函数的调用
    startDraging参数解释:
    initAim   目标层名称     initSource  拖拽源名称    initClone 用于复制的层的名称  
    initAimX  目标层x轴坐标  initAimY    目标层y轴坐标 initOrgnX 拖拽源x坐标        initOrgnY 拖拽源Y轴坐标

    仅IE里面测试通过.代码里面添加了注释.可以在拖拽源到达目标之后添加写xml的操作.进而记录用户自定义页面排版的数据.对于返回动画的算法还不是很满意.希望各位多多提些建议.以便完善.小弟当前致力于开发一套基于asp.net2.0的ajax控件.希望多多交流.
